Jean Monnet Module on Social Solidarity Economy

The project Jean Monnet Module “Social Solidarity Economy: implementing EU experience for Sustainable Development” (SSExpEU – 101047518 – GAP-101047518, 2022-2025)

Since February 2022, teachers of the Department of Economics, Entrepreneurship and Business Administration of Sumy State University have been implementing a grant of the European Commission, the Jean Monnet Module project “Social Solidarity Economy: implementing EU experience for Sustainable Development” (SSExpEU – 101047518 – GAP-101047518, 2022-2025). The performes of the module are Doctor of Science (Econ.), Prof. Sotnyk I. M., Doctor of Science (Econ.), Prof. Melnyk L.G., Ph.D. (Econ.), Associate Professor Chortok Yu.V. and Ph.D. (Econ.), Associate Professor Kubatko O.Vik. The project is designed to encourage students to master the progressive directions of economy’s socialization and solidarity in the EU, as well as explore the possibilities of their implementation in Ukraine. The involvement of young and experienced specialists in this project will allow to develop innovative methods of teaching and researching European integration. The main result of the project for its participants will be an increase in the level of awareness of European studios, which will bring additional value in their future careers, create prerequisites for the solidarity of society and support young people in their professional growth.

Within the module, it is expected: a) publication of an electronic study aid, scientific articles on the module topic; b) development of educational interactive game “Alphabet of  the social and solidarity economy terms”; с) creation of an open online course; d) publication of a monograph on the module topic; e) inclusion of social solidarity economy topics in conferences at Sumy State University; e) promotion of network activities within the framework of civil society, partners and networks of higher education institutions by holding round tables, conferences, other educational and scientific events, etc.
